## Data Stores — Scanline Dock Integration

Quick notes for the sync: the handheld scanner gateway now writes scan events straight to the events store instead of queueing through Relaybin. Less lag, but watch write volume during receiving hours. Lookup tables for SKU-to-barcode mappings live in the same database. If you want to poke at it, connect with the string below.

replica DSN, yahog-kawig: redis://istox_svc:um@db-8a67.halixforge.test:5432/frawyn

## TumbleGate: locker won't open

If a customer reports the laundry-locker door not releasing after a valid pickup code, first check the TumbleGate access service — nine times out of ten it's a stale session on the door controller, not the app. Bounce the controller agent and have them retry. If that doesn't fix it, escalate to the Fennick hub team. When escalating, include the service's current configuration values, reproduced below.

deployment values, kajep-kageg:
[praix]
host = praix.paliqcorp.corp
user = praix_svc
database = praix_prod

Welcome aboard! The Snackline restock planner decides which machines get visited each morning. It scores every machine on predicted sell-through, distance from the Dorvale depot, and how stale the last visit is, then packs routes greedily until the van's capacity is hit. Don't overthink the scoring math yet — most of the behavior comes from a handful of knobs we tune seasonally. The current constants we ship with are listed here.

tuning table, yajog-yahof:
BUDGETS = {
    "lamvan": 303,
    "wenox": 460,
    "fenvan": 525,
}